Today's Word is coming from Isaiah chapter 48:12-13 (NKJV)

12."Listen to Me, O Jacob, and Israel, My called: I am He, I am the First, I am also the Last.

13.Indeed My hand has laid the foundation of the earth, and my right hand has stretched out the heavens; when I call to them, they stand up together."


Amen, thank you LORD.


In chapter 48, we see the LORD reminding His people of His all powerful and mighty nature. Something to note is God reminds His people, not their opposition or enemies, but His people of His unending love and the power to deliver them. Friend, this is the expression of God's faithfulness towards you. When He promises to deliver you from every scheme and plan of the enemy - believe Him.

Another reason God reminds His people of His power is to invalidate the clutter and noise that clouds the judgment of His people.In this chapter, we see God's people have previously wandered from His way, worshipping idols and partaking in all activities that would break any parent's heart but as a Father, God tells His people, He is willing to overlook that for the sake of love to redeem His own. Friend, this is the level of God's commitment concerning His children. Your sucess and well being are of paramount importance to God. The LORD God always has our best interests at heart and in Isaiah 48:17 NKJV, He says, "Thus says the LORD your Redeemer, the Holy One of Israel: "I am the LORD your God, who teaches you to profit, who leads you by the way you should go."


Unfortunately, in the following verses, we see that the people did not yield to the LORD's commandments. Instead, they chose their own ways. As a result, the LORD tells His people that if they had chosen His way, they would have experienced an abundance of peace, righteousness and multiple descendants, their children filling up their land and glorifying His name (Isaiah 48:18-19). So we learn that in following God's way or His teaching, we shall find profit, peace, righteousness and an abundance that glorifies His name.

Nevertheless, God's people choosing their ways never deters His love. In Isaiah 48:20 NKJV, God continues to pursue His own and urges them to be separated from their enemies and rejoice with singing. That is, "Go forth from Babylon! Flee from the Chaldeans! With a voice of singing, declare, proclaim this, utter it to the end of the earth; say, "The LORD has redeemed His servant Jacob!"
